A 30 back 2-1B recently went on ebay for just shy of £600. I reckon £300-750 for the debut figures, especially if they are in that good condition. Would think Lando, Luke, Han and Leia would be at the top end. Not sure on the Ben- dunno how rare it is.

you could be looking at up to £1k on most of those though it's very fickle at the moment. A figure sell for £1k then a few weeks late the same figure comes in at £600

A Luke Bespin sold for £2k a while back and everyone thought that was overpriced. Then one sold for £5k the other week!

HST is probably the rarer of the ESB characters you listed. So currently I'd have thought £1k would be the starting point

Ben is one of the more common 30 backs Star Wars characters, but still, probably rarer than the others on that list. It's a hard one to value. The last two I know of that sold were back in 2004. One went for £900 the other went for £1k. Though I really don't think that's anything to go by though. They were sold alongside other 30 backs which were around £4-600 depending on character, so if you consider how much some of those now go for you could increase the Ben from £1k in a similar amount. It's still just a guess.


The problem with Ben is that he debuts on a 12 back, so debut collectors are more interested in the 12 than the 30. On the other hand he's rarer than the 12. I'd start at £2k and go from there.
